Crawlspace Sealing in Grand Rapids, MI

Crawlspace sealing services involve enclosing and insulating the space beneath a home to improve energy efficiency and prevent moisture intrusion. This process typically includes sealing gaps, vents, and cracks, as well as adding insulation to create a barrier against outside air and humidity. Projects often focus on homes experiencing drafts, high utility bills, or signs of moisture problems such as mold or wood rot. Property owners usually want to understand how the sealing will impact indoor comfort, reduce energy costs, and protect the structural integrity of the foundation.

Before requesting crawlspace sealing, homeowners should consider the current condition of their crawlspace, including any existing moisture issues or pest activity. It is helpful to know if there are vents, access points, or existing insulation that may need to be addressed or removed. Understanding the scope of the project and any necessary repairs can ensure the sealing process is effective and long-lasting. Proper preparation and assessment can contribute to a healthier, more energy-efficient home environment.

Project Types

Common Crawlspace Sealing Jobs

Foundation and crawlspace sealing - helps prevent drafts and reduces energy loss in homes.

Moisture barrier installation - protects against mold growth and structural damage caused by humidity.

Air leak sealing - minimizes unwanted airflow and improves indoor comfort.

Vapor barrier upgrades - keeps crawlspaces dry and prevents wood rot and pest issues.

Insulation sealing - enhances thermal efficiency by blocking drafts around ductwork and wiring.

Access point sealing - closes gaps around vents and entryways for a tighter, more secure crawlspace.

Crawlspace Sealing Questions

What is crawlspace sealing? Crawlspace sealing involves closing gaps and vents to prevent unwanted air, moisture, and pests from entering the space beneath a home.

Why should homeowners consider crawlspace sealing? Sealing can improve indoor comfort, reduce energy costs, and prevent issues caused by moisture and pests.

What materials are used for crawlspace sealing? Common materials include vapor barriers, spray foam insulation, and sealant tapes to block air leaks and moisture intrusion.

Is crawlspace sealing suitable for all homes? It is generally beneficial for homes with unsealed or vented crawlspaces, especially in climates like Grand Rapids, MI, to improve energy efficiency and indoor air quality.
